Skip to main content
Publicación recuperada por Daniel Rosillo
se añadieron 19 caracteres en el cuerpo
Origen Enlace

Esto se resuelve mas fácilmente utilizandoDentro de tu clase vendedor necesitas generar los hashcode and equals methods(los IDES los pueden generar de manera automática).

Luego aplicando un poco de programación funcional.... Suponiendo que ya has definido el código para saber si un objeto es igual a otro prueba esto.

    juntados = (ArrayList<Vendedor>) vendedor.stream().distinct().collect(Collectors.toList());

Esto se resuelve mas fácilmente utilizando programación funcional.... Suponiendo que ya has definido el código para saber si un objeto es igual a otro prueba esto.

    juntados = (ArrayList<Vendedor>) vendedor.stream().distinct().collect(Collectors.toList());

Dentro de tu clase vendedor necesitas generar los hashcode and equals methods(los IDES los pueden generar de manera automática).

Luego aplicando un poco de programación funcional...

    juntados = (ArrayList<Vendedor>) vendedor.stream().distinct().collect(Collectors.toList());
Publicación eliminada por Daniel Rosillo
Origen Enlace

Esto se resuelve mas fácilmente utilizando programación funcional.... Suponiendo que ya has definido el código para saber si un objeto es igual a otro prueba esto.

    juntados = (ArrayList<Vendedor>) vendedor.stream().distinct().collect(Collectors.toList());